Andrew Webster Biography
Andrew Webster is renowned primarily in two distinct fields: as an Australian professional rugby league coach and as an English sociologist with significant academic contributions. The rugby league Andrew Webster is famous as the head coach of the New Zealand Warriors in the National Rugby League (NRL), holding a strong coaching career that includes key roles at Hull Kingston Rovers, Wests Tigers, Penrith Panthers, and the Warriors. Meanwhile, the English sociologist Andrew Webster was notable for establishing the Science and Technology Studies research unit at the University of York and for his work examining the sociocultural and economic implications of biomedical technologies.
Childhood
The rugby coach Andrew Webster was born on January 17, 1982, in Sydney, New South Wales, Australia. Growing up in Australia, he developed a strong connection with rugby league from a young age, later transitioning from player to coach. On the other hand, Andrew Webster the sociologist was born in 1951 in England; specific details about his family background are less documented but he grew up during a time when social sciences were gaining prominence as a field of study.
Education
Andrew Webster the sociologist earned his Bachelor of Science degree in social sciences from the Polytechnic of the South Bank in 1974, followed by a PhD in sociology of science from the University of York in 1981. His academic training prepared him to delve deeply into the study of science and technology from a sociological perspective. Conversely, the rugby league Andrew Webster's formal education is less publicly noted, but his early playing and coaching experience in rugby league clubs effectively formed the foundation for his professional sports career.
Career
In his coaching career, Andrew Webster started young at 23 and quickly rose through ranks, initially serving as an assistant coach at Hull Kingston Rovers in the Super League. He later held important coaching positions at several NRL clubs, including the Wests Tigers and Penrith Panthers, before becoming the head coach of the New Zealand Warriors in 2023. His debut year as a head coach was marked by leading the Warriors to a top-four finish and receiving the Dally M Coach of the Year award. The sociologist Andrew Webster built an esteemed academic career at the University of York, founding the Science and Technology Studies Unit, conducting extensive research on biomedical technologies, and making influential contributions to understanding technological adoption in healthcare systems globally.
Family Life
The rugby league Andrew Webster is the younger brother of James Webster, who is also a rugby league coach. Details about his personal relationships or children are not widely publicized. Achievements
Andrew Webster the rugby coach has led teams to notable successes, including coaching the Warriors to a playoff-contending season and contributing as an assistant coach to Penrith Panthers’ premiership wins in 2021 and 2022. He is awarded the Dally M Coach of the Year. The sociologist Andrew Webster was honored with a Fellowship at the Academy of Social Sciences in 2007 and the 4S Mentoring Award in 2017, recognizing his impact on social science research and mentorship in science and technology studies.
